If he were on vacation in Florida as a kid
and saw a girl drowning in a pool,
wondered, in the time standing still,
“Why isn’t anyone doing anything?
Where are her parents?
How can all the adults carry on laughing,
slapping lotions, reading books?”
and in the time it takes afterwards,
had he dived in and pulled
her rag doll body off the bottom, heaved her
onto the steps with his arms around her belly,
smacked her on the back, watched her cough up water,
held her there until she looked him in the eyes,
and they climbed out, she to her family, he to his,
clothes dripping in a hotel room,
to get what he got for making the carpet wet,
the bathroom a mess, his clothes wrecked,
would he never again dive? Make it a rule,
if he were on vacation and saw a girl
drowning in a pool?
